Output faa59b3ff3540081fb6f054938a29805ecfbcab69a843cc06abefb42011c5038:0

value
1043306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60d7f20aa1c9165a108ffd6fd61e797b3bbbf45 OP_EQUAL
address
3MCphMYuKs4BAAnemmoNzPSmdx5qnu9DeL
transaction
faa59b3ff3540081fb6f054938a29805ecfbcab69a843cc06abefb42011c5038
spent
true